RESPONSIBILITIES:

Kforce has a client that is seeking a Program Manager - Executive Communications in Canton, MA.Summary:We are seeking an experienced Program Manager with a strong background in healthcare payer solutions and Medicaid/Medicare to lead the strategic executive alignment and communication of our healthcare client's program roadmap. This role involves extensive coordination with executive stakeholders to ensure seamless implementation of healthcare strategies within a payer context. You will manage and deliver complex projects that have a direct impact, working under the Program Director to oversee day-to-day supports of the program.Key Responsibilities:
  • Collaborate with executive stakeholders to understand their vision and ensure the program roadmap reflects strategic healthcare payer objectives
  • Effectively communicate with all levels of the organization to ensure clarity and visibility of program initiatives
  • Oversee the planning, execution, and delivery of program milestones, ensuring that program protocols are followed by all project managers
  • Act as an escalation point for business project managers, providing support for higher-level communications to leadership and program-level meetings
  • Lead cross-work thread deliverables to ensure coordination, while delegating work thread-specific activities to the relevant project manager and work thread
  • Address program-level scope, issues, risks, and quality, implementing corrective measures as needed
  • Facilitate negotiations and set realistic timelines with stakeholders, ensuring commitments are achievable and aligned with strategic goals
  • Provide transparent and regular updates on program status, including health, risks, and milestones to clients and stakeholders
  • Ensure all program deliverables meet the high-quality standards required in the healthcare industry and are delivered on schedule
Types of Projects Under the Program:
  • Product and Provider
  • Clinical and Finance/Risk Adjustment


REQUIREMENTS:

  • Program Management: 15+ years in combined project & program management with a proven 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ously while prioritizing based on organizational goals
  • Executive Stakeholder Communication: 10+ years of experience
  • Project Management Foundations: Strong foundations in planning, scope, issue and risk, and quality management
Nice to Have:
  • Healthcare Experience: Experience leading projects in the healthcare payer sector
  • Problem-Solving Skills: Decisive and efficient problem-solving skills with a track record of timely project delivery
  • Project Management Methodologies: Experience with both Waterfall and Agile project management methodologies
  • Communication Tools: Expertise in Microsoft PowerPoint to effectively communicate program strategies and statuses
